In the current digital era, they have become an imminent danger to people, companies, many different sectors globally. advantage of short comingsand confidential information interference with business processes. Understanding how to protect your website from hackers and prevent cyber theft is essential for maintaining security and trust. provides a comprehensive guide on protecting against a cyber attack and preventing cybersecurity threats.
Understanding Cyber Attacks
Cyber attacks take on multiple forms, including phishing, malware, ransomware, denial-of-service (DoS) attacks, and data breaches. Hackers use these methods to gain unauthorized access, compromise data, and exploit security weaknesses. Taking proactive measures is crucial to safeguarding your online assets.
1. Secure Your Website with HTTPS
One of the most basic steps for protecting your website from hackers is using HTTPS, which encrypts data transferred between the user’s browser and your website, making it difficult for hackers to intercept and manipulate the information on the website.
How to Implement HTTPS:
- Purchase an SSL certificate from a trusted provider.
- Install the SSL certificate on your web server.
- Ensure all website pages redirect from HTTP to HTTPS.
- Regularly renew your SSL certificate to maintain security.
2. Use Strong Passwords and Multi-Factor Authentication (MFA)
Weak passwords are a leading cause of cyber breaches. Strong passwords and MFA provide an extra layer of security against unauthorized access.
Best Practices:
- Use passwords with at least 12-16 characters, including uppercase and lowercase letters, numbers, and symbols.
- Avoid using easily guessable passwords like “password123” or “admin.”
- Enable multi-factor authentication (MFA) on all important accounts, requiring an additional verification step like a one-time code.
3. Keep Software, Plugins, and CMS Updated
Outdated software and plugins are common vulnerabilities that hackers exploit. Regular updates help patch security flaws and improve defence mechanisms.
How to Stay Updated:
- Enable automatic updates for your CMS, plugins, and security tools.
- Regularly check for patches and updates.
- Remove outdated or unnecessary plugins and themes to reduce security risks.
4. Install a Web Application Firewall (WAF)
A Web Application Firewall (WAF) helps protect against cyber threats by filtering malicious traffic before it reaches your website.
Benefits of WAF:
- Blocks SQL injections, cross-site scripting (XSS), and DDoS attacks.
- Monitors incoming traffic and filters suspicious activities.
- Protects sensitive data and prevents unauthorized access.
5. Regularly Backup Your Website
Making a backup of your website guarantees that you can promptly restore it in the event of a cyberattack.
Best Backup Practices:
- Schedule daily or weekly automated backups.
- Store backups in multiple locations, including cloud storage and external drives.
- Regularly test backups to ensure they are functional.
6. Use Secure Web Hosting Services
Your web hosting provider plays a critical role in your website’s security. Choosing a secure hosting provider helps prevent cyber threats and data breaches.
What to Look for in a Hosting Provider:
- Regular security updates and monitoring.
- DDoS protection to prevent attacks.
- Secure file permissions and access control measures.
- Malware scanning and removal services.
7. Monitor Website Traffic and Security Logs
Regular website traffic monitoring helps detect potential security threats before they cause harm.
Tools for Monitoring:
- Google Analytics for tracking website traffic.
- Security plugins that provide real-time alerts.
- Server logs to review suspicious login attempts and access patterns.
8. Train Employees on Cybersecurity Awareness
Many cyber attacks exploit human errors. Educating your employees on how to prevent cybersecurity attacks reduces risks.
Cybersecurity Training Tips:
- Teach employees how to recognize phishing emails and scams.
- Restrict access to sensitive data and implement role-based permissions.
- Conduct regular security awareness training and simulated attack exercises.
9. Protect Against Malware and Viruses
Malware infections can compromise website data and functionality. Robust security software helps protect against cyber threats.
How to Secure Your Website from Malware:
- Use reliable security plugins and antivirus software.
- Schedule frequent malware scans and remove infected files immediately.
- Implement file integrity monitoring to detect unauthorized changes.
10. Implement Role-Based Access Control (RBAC)
Limiting user access to sensitive areas of your website minimizes security risks.
RBAC Best Practices:
- Assign specific roles with appropriate permissions.
- Restrict admin-level access to authorized personnel only.
- Regularly review and update user roles as needed.
11. Secure Your Database
Your website’s database contains valuable data that should and must be protected against cyber threats.
How to Secure Your Database
- Use complex database passwords and restrict access.
- Regularly back up database files and store them securely.
- Implement encryption to protect sensitive data.
12. Use CAPTCHA to Prevent Automated Attacks
Automated bots can exploit website vulnerabilities. CAPTCHA helps prevent cyber theft by blocking unauthorized bots
Where to Use CAPTCHA:
- Login pages
- Contact forms
- Payment gateways
13. Monitor and Respond to Security Threats
An incident response plan ensures quick action in a cyber attack.
Incident Response Steps:
- Identify and isolate affected systems.
- Notify relevant authorities if sensitive data is compromised.
- Restore backups and strengthen security measures.
14. Limit File Upload Permissions
Allowing unrestricted file uploads increases security risks. Hackers can upload malicious scripts to exploit your website.
How to Secure File Uploads:
- Restrict file types and sizes.
- Scan uploaded files for malware.
- Store uploaded files outside the root directory.
15. Enable Intrusion Detection and Prevention Systems (IDPS)
An IDPS helps detect and block threats before they cause harm.
Benefits of IDPS:
- Monitors network traffic for suspicious activities.
- Prevents unauthorized access to sensitive data.
- Provides real-time alerts to security teams.
16. Conduct Regular Security Audits
Routine security audits help identify vulnerabilities and improve defence mechanisms.
Key Areas to Audit:
- Website vulnerabilities and weak passwords.
- Security settings and firewall configurations.
- Access controls and user permissions.
17. Establish a Disaster Recovery Plan
A disaster recovery plan ensures business continuity during a cyber attack.
Components of a Recovery Plan:
- Define roles and responsibilities for security incidents.
- Maintain secure backups for data recovery.
- Implement quick response measures to minimize downtime.
18. Secure IoT and Third-Party Integrations
Internet of Things (IoT) devices and third-party applications can introduce security risks.
How to Secure Integrations:
- Use trusted third-party applications with security guarantees.
- Regularly update IoT firmware and turn off unnecessary features.
- Implement network segmentation to isolate IoT devices from sensitive data.
Conclusion
Protecting against cyber attacks requires a proactive, multi-layered approach. Implementing strong passwords, enabling firewalls, keeping software updated, and educating employees can significantly reduce the risk of cyber threats. These practices will help safeguard your website, prevent cyber theft, and maintain a secure online presence. By taking these steps, you can enhance cybersecurity measures and keep your data and digital assets safe from hackers.